LPV821 - Zero-Drift Amplifier

General Description

The LPV821 is a single-channel, nanopower, zerodrift operational amplifier for “Always ON” sensing applications in wireless and wired equipment where low input offset is required.

Key Features

  • 1 Quiescent Current: 650 nA.
  • Low Offset Voltage: ±10 μV (Maximum).
  • Offset Voltage Drift: ±0.096 μV/°C (Maximum).
  • 0.1-Hz to 10-Hz Noise: 3.9 μVPP.
  • Input Bias Current: ±7 pA.
  • Gain Bandwidth: 8 kHz.
  • Supply Voltage: 1.7 V to 3.6 V.
  • Rail-to-Rail Input/Output.
  • Industry Standard Package.
  • Single in 5-pin SOT-23.
  • EMI Hardened 2.
